The Versatility and Importance of 45 Foot Containers in Modern Logistics
In the vast and intricate world of international trade and logistics, the 45-foot container sticks out as an important component. These containers, somewhat longer than the basic 40-foot models, offer improved capacity and versatility, making them vital in the effective movement of goods around the world. This post looks into the characteristics, utilizes, and benefits of 45-foot containers, providing a detailed introduction of their function in modern-day logistics.
What is a 45-Foot Container?
A 45 Foot containers-foot container, also referred to as a high cube container, measures 45 feet in length, 8 feet in width, and 9 feet 6 inches in height. This additional length and height offer a substantial boost in volume compared to standard 40-foot containers, which are 8 feet 6 inches in height. The extra area is particularly useful for carrying large or abundant items, such as furniture, machinery, and automobile parts.
Secret Features of 45-Foot Containers
Increased Capacity: The 45-foot container offers a volume of around 3,060 cubic feet, which is about 10% more than a standard 40-foot container. This extra area can accommodate more products, decreasing the number of containers required for a shipment and potentially lowering transportation expenses.
Resilience and Security: Like other ISO-standard New 45ft containers, 45 ft shipping container-foot containers are developed to stand up to the rigors of worldwide shipping. They are made from premium products, such as corten steel, and are equipped with robust locking mechanisms to make sure the security and security of the cargo.
Versatility: These containers appropriate for a wide variety of goods, from consumer electronic devices to building products. They can be filled and unloaded using standard container dealing with devices, making them suitable with existing logistics infrastructure.
Cost-Effectiveness: Despite the preliminary higher cost of a 45-foot container, the increased capacity frequently leads to cost savings in the long run. Less containers indicate less handling operations, minimized fuel intake, and lower general shipping costs.
Applications of 45-Foot Containers
Retail and Consumer Goods: Retailers and e-commerce business typically use 45-foot containers to ship big volumes of durable goods, such as clothes, electronics, and home devices. The additional space permits more effective usage of warehouse and warehouse area.
Automotive Industry: The automobile market gain from 45-foot containers for transporting automobile parts, such as engines, transmissions, and body panels. The increased capacity can accommodate more parts, decreasing the number of deliveries and enhancing the supply chain.
Furniture and Home Decor: Furniture makers and home decor companies often utilize 45-foot containers to deliver bulky items like sofas, tables, and bed mattress. The additional area makes sure that these products can be packed more efficiently, lowering the risk of damage throughout transit.
Building And Construction and Industrial Equipment: Construction companies and industrial makers use 45-foot containers to transfer heavy machinery, tools, and materials. The extra height and length are particularly beneficial for items that can not be quickly divided or compressed.

FAQs About 45-Foot Containers
Q: What is the distinction in between a 45-foot container and a 40-foot 45ft container shipping?
A: A 45-foot 45ft container prices is 5 feet longer than a 40-foot container and has a height of 9 feet 6 inches, compared to 8 feet 6 inches for a basic 40-foot container. The extra length and height provide more volume and capacity for products.
Q: Are 45-foot containers more costly than 40-foot containers?
A: Yes, 45-foot containers are normally more costly than 40-foot containers due to their larger size and increased capacity. Nevertheless, the cost savings from fewer deliveries and lowered handling can typically offset the preliminary higher cost.
Q: Can 45-foot containers be used for air freight?
A: No, 45-foot containers are mainly developed for sea and land transportation. Air cargo usually utilizes smaller, specialized containers that are better fit for airplane cargo holds.
Q: Are 45-foot containers suitable for all types of cargo?
A: While 45-foot containers are flexible and can accommodate a broad variety of items, they may not appropriate for all types of cargo. For instance, extremely heavy or harmful products may need specific containers or extra handling preventative measures.
Q: How are 45-foot containers loaded and unloaded?
A: 45-foot containers are packed and unloaded using standard container handling equipment, such as cranes and forklifts. The process resembles that of standard 40-foot containers, guaranteeing compatibility with existing logistics infrastructure.
